Earthquake statistics
Average number of earthquakes
- Mag. 8 or higher: 0.02 quakes per year (or 1 quake every 41.7 years)
- Mag. 7 or higher: 0.27 quakes per year (or 1 quake every 3.6 years)
- Mag. 6 or higher: 2.7 quakes per year
- Mag. 5 or higher: 18.8 quakes per year
- Mag. 4 or higher: 116 quakes per year (or 9.6 quakes per month)
- Mag. 3 or higher: 516 quakes per year (or 43 quakes per month)
- Mag. 2 or higher: 1,600 quakes per year (or 4.3 quakes per day)
- Mag. 1 or higher: 1,800 quakes per year (or 4.9 quakes per day)

Davao Earthquake FAQ
+How frequent are earthquakes in or near Davao, Philippines?
Davao has a very high level of seismic activity. Based on data from the past 14 years and our earthquake archive back to 1900, there are about 1,800 quakes on average per year in or near Davao, Philippines. Davao has had at least 3 quakes above magnitude 8 since 1900, which suggests that larger earthquakes of this size occur infrequently, probably on average approximately every 40 to 45 years.
